When did The Handmaid's Tale Season 3 Episode 8 air?
The Handmaid's Tale Season 3 Episode 8 aired on July 10, 2019.

Set in a dystopian future, a woman is forced to live as a concubine under a fundamentalist theocratic dictatorship.

June and the rest of the Handmaids shun Ofmatthew, and both are pushed to their limit at the hands of Aunt Lydia. Aunt Lydia reflects on her life and relationships before the rise of Gilead.
